1. The Basics: What is Shijiazhuang Cultural Media School? 🎓

First things first, let’s get to know Shijiazhuang Cultural Media School. Located in Hebei Province, China, this institution focuses on training students in various aspects of media and cultural arts. Whether you’re into broadcasting, journalism, or performing arts, this school has got you covered. 🎤🎥

3. The Verdict: Shijiazhuang Cultural Media School is... 🎉

Drumroll, please! 🥁 After digging through the details, we can confirm that Shijiazhuang Cultural Media School is indeed a **public** institution. This means it’s funded by the government and aims to provide quality education to a broad student base. 🏫👩‍🎓👨‍🎓
What does this mean for you? If you’re considering enrolling, you’ll likely benefit from lower tuition fees and a more diverse student body. Plus, the school’s public status ensures a level of accountability and adherence to educational standards set by the government. 📜✅
